Charles Leclerc reveals that he was ‘remembering his father during the last 15 laps’ before winning the historic Monaco Grand Prix.

Charles Leclerc delivers an incredibly impressive performance during the 78-lap Monaco Grand Prix. The Scuderia Ferrari driver showed his true potential once again as he crossed the finish line to claim victory at the Monaco Grand Prix, marking his first win of the 2024 season for passionate Ferrari fans. Leclerc, who hails from Monaco, became the first driver from his home country to win at the prestigious Monaco circuit and now has a total of six career victories.

It was a dream come true for Charles Leclerc on Sunday, as he triumphed in his own home race, a feat he had failed to achieve on two separate occasions despite starting from pole position. Leclerc showed immense determination over the 78 laps and secured the checkered flag with an eight-second advantage over his nearest competitor, who finished in second place.

The 26-year-old driver led the race from start to finish after an exceptional performance on Saturday, where he secured pole position in Monte Carlo. Reflecting on his victory, Leclerc mentioned how the memory of his father inspired him to fight through the final 15 laps of the race after a fiercely competitive afternoon in Monte Carlo.

Charles Leclerc expressed his emotions after the win, struggling to find words to describe his feelings. He recalled his previous experiences of starting from pole position twice but failing to convert it into a victory. However, this time luck was on his side, and he was fueled by his father’s efforts in shaping his career during the final stages of the race. This additional motivation proved crucial in securing his first win in Monaco.

The director of the Ferrari team, Fred Vasseur, acknowledged the demanding nature of the Monaco Grand Prix and praised Leclerc for his brilliant performance. Vasseur highlighted the importance of this inaugural victory for Leclerc in Monaco, emphasizing the long wait for such an achievement.

The Monaco event proved to be a success for the Ferrari team, as both drivers secured podium finishes and showed exceptional management of their pace and tire strategy throughout the 78 laps of the race. Vasseur expressed his satisfaction with the team’s performance and recognized the memorable nature of Leclerc’s victory, considering it a significant milestone for the Monegasque driver.

Following their strong performance in Monaco, the Maranello-based team has reduced the gap to championship leaders Red Bull to just 24 points in the constructors’ championship. Moving forward, Ferrari aims to maintain their impressive form and continue closing the margin to Red Bull and their competitors.
